Application of the Direct-Gain Passive Solar House on Middle and Small-Sized Public Building

Article Preview

Abstract:

This paper starts from research in characteristics of the direct-gain passive solar house and presents the practical significance for the application of the house in small and midsize public building. The concrete methods are illustrated from location selection, external form, internal room arrangement, ventilation and maintenance structure and so on, which clarify the application way of the direct-gain passive solar house in the building. The purpose of this research is to reduce the energy consumption of the building itself and achieve building energy conservation.
